Omotola Flourishes In 'Barren Land'
Undoubtedly, one of Africa's blessings to the entertainment industry, Omotola Jalade-Ekeinde popularly known as Omosexy, has continued to show that she can bring make rain fall in the desert throughout the year.
She has grown to become a threat to many of her contemporaries, who are struggling to match up with her worst performance and lowest achievement. No wonder TIME magazine named her as one of the most influential figures in the world, in the icon category.
The beautiful mother and wife, who radiates the aura of a real star, has again released a new single. The complete and down-to-earth singer, fighter and humanitarian released a single entitled 'Barren Land' off her forthcoming album, Me, Myself and Eyes.
The single was produced by Del-B, the magical hand behind KCee's 'Limpopo hit single, which fetched him a car gift from the MTN brand ambassador singer.
